Early College is part of the “Learn & Earn” initiative launched by Governor Mike Easely in 2004. It provides the opportunity for students in grades 9 – 12 to earn both a high school diploma and a two-year degree or two years of transferrable credit in four or five years, tuition free. WebMar 8, 2024 · For a grade of D, 28% of traditional comprehensive high schools received this grade, whereas no early colleges did. Though it should be noted that there are significant limitations with the current criteria for grading schools, this performance for North Carolina’s 98 early colleges is one worth lifting up and exploring further.
